Ah well, Emotional Quotient you see, is also known as Emotional Intelligence. It's like having  a relaxed afternoon tea in the rain, a set of skills that help us recognize, understand, and manage our own emotions and the emotions of others. While IQ measures how clever we are, EQ tells us our emotional awareness and social savvy. It's like putting on a top hat and speaking with a delightful British accent. Cheers, aye....

Now chappies, developing self-awareness is as essential as understanding the proper way to hold a teacup in a social gathering. It allows us to recognize our own emotions, strengths, and limitations. This awareness helps us keep our emotions in check and make smart decisions, even when work gets as chaotic as a flock of seagulls at a seaside picnic. As its said, keep your chin high, mates.

And, oh yes, we must never let our emotions run wild like a pack of unruly corgis. Effective self-regulation means managing our emotions and responses in a positively strong way, like a trooper in a sword fight. It keeps us from blurting out the first thing that comes to mind and helps create a proper work environment that promotes inclusivity and tolerance.

In these turbulent times, staying motivated can be as challenging as finding the perfect recipe for milk biscuits. However, folks with high EQ are like resilient oak trees, strong and dependable. They adapt to change, stay focused on their goals, and inspire others with their strong attitude, creating a supportive and productive work environment.

Ah, we cannot overlook empathy, the secret ingredient to a splendid work relationship. It's like understanding someone's love for cricket or their obsession with soccer. Empathy involves understanding and sharing the feelings of others, creating a sense of camaraderie and connection. By sharpening our empathy skills, we can navigate conflicts with the finesse of a county cricket match of yester-years and resolve misunderstandings with a cuppa tea and a tasty biscuit.

Then, there is the art of socializing, like attending a delightful garden party of social A-listers. Strong social skills allow us to communicate effectively, build relationships, and collaborate with others. In the face of intolerance and stress, individuals with high EQ are expert hosts, fostering open dialogue, managing conflicts with the grace of a royal wedding, and nurturing a cooperative work environment.
